Lazy eye (amblyopia): what it is and how it’s treated

If the term “lazy eye” sounds strange, leave the laziness aside and keep reading!

“Lazy eye” is the everyday term for amblyopia, an eye condition in which the affected eye is essentially “not chosen” by the brain.

What actually happens is that one eye (usually only one) fails to focus properly, sending inaccurate visual information to the brain. This results in the brain’s “rejection” of this blurred input.

This neurological dysfunction affects about 5% of the population and appears in early childhood. It’s important to understand that if amblyopia is not diagnosed and treated early, there is no way to correct it later in life. The brain’s “visual learning” occurs only during the first nine years of life.

Think of the brain as a malleable entity: if it doesn’t receive the right visual training tools early on, it will not be able to reprogram itself later — even if the optical input becomes clearer.

The types of amblyopia are as follows:

  • Anisometropic amblyopia: A refractive error where the two eyes have different prescriptions, causing the brain to receive mismatched images it cannot merge.
  • Strabismic amblyopia: Caused by misalignment of the eyes (strabismus), leading to a permanent decrease in visual acuity in the affected eye.
  • Deprivation amblyopia: Results from reduced visual input in infancy or early childhood, often due to cloudiness in the optical media (e.g., cataract), and can affect both eyes.

In the case amblyopia is diagnosed, the child and their parents need patience, discipline, and consistency in following one or more of the following approaches:

  • Patching of the “good” eye. By covering the eye that sees well, we push the lazy eye — and the corresponding anatomical area of the brain — to try harder and eventually begin the proper reception of stimuli that until that point were not being correctly received. (Covering is recommended for 2 hours per day during moments of creative activity, such as drawing, reading, or playing.) It is very important that this training of the affected eye takes place under the constant supervision and guidance of a specialized doctor.
  • Atropine eye drops. In certain cases, the use of drops that temporarily blur the “good” eye is recommended, so that the brain focuses on gathering visual information from the “amblyopic” eye, thus functioning as an alternative to patching in cases of the child’s non-compliance.
  • Use of eyeglasses or contact lenses. The effectiveness of this option is lower and not always successful, yet it corrects the myopic or hypermetropic deviation between the two eyes.
  • Surgery. Without constituting a direct treatment, such a method is indicated in cases of strabismic amblyopia, offering alignment of the eyes and improvement of binocular cooperation.
  • Electronic glasses (amblis). These, for short periods of time, blur the healthy eye in a programmed manner, resulting in the burden of vision falling on the affected eye.

Whichever method one chooses, the most important piece of information concerns the age limit and the importance of timely treatment of amblyopia (up to 9 years old for strabismic amblyopia and up to 10 for anisometropic).

The key milestones for children’s eye exams are:

  • 1st day of life
  • 1st year of life
  • 3rd year of life
  • Every 2 years thereafter
